The global rotator cuff injury treatment market is on a steady expansion path, with demand expected to rise from an estimated $4.1 billion in 2026 to about $6.9 billion by 2033, reflecting a projected CAGR of 7.7% across the forecast period. Growth is being supported by an aging population, higher sports participation, better diagnosis through imaging, and wider access to arthroscopic repair and biologic support products. The market includes surgical repair systems, anchors, sutures, biologics, rehabilitation services, pain management, and bracing solutions that are used for both partial and full-thickness tears. Demand is also shaped by the growing preference for minimally invasive procedures and the clinical need to reduce recovery time and retear rates.
Between 2019 and 2025, the market moved through a clear recovery and expansion cycle. It was valued at roughly $2.8 billion in 2019, slowed in 2020 as elective procedures were deferred, then recovered to around $3.2 billion in 2021 and $3.6 billion in 2022 as surgical volumes normalized. By 2023 and 2024, the market reached approximately $3.9 billion and $4.0 billion, with 2025 estimated near $4.05 billion, helped by higher procedure backlogs and broader use of outpatient orthopedic care. The 2026 base year at $4.1 billion reflects a market that is mature in core surgical devices but still gaining share from biologic augmentation, single-row to double-row repair preferences, and better post-operative rehabilitation pathways. From 2026 to 2033, the $2.8 billion of incremental value will come mainly from procedure growth, device innovation, and wider treatment access in emerging markets.
In the United States, the market remains the largest and most procedure-intensive, with 2026 spending estimated near $1.55 billion and forecast growth close to 7% annually through 2033. Demand is supported by high diagnostic rates, extensive outpatient surgery capacity, and strong adoption of arthroscopic repair systems, especially among patients over 50 and among recreational athletes. Private hospital systems and ambulatory surgical centers continue to invest in faster recovery protocols, while payer pressure keeps attention on value-based implant selection and reduced revision rates. The country also leads in premium biologics and next-generation fixation systems, which gives manufacturers a sizable but demanding commercial environment.
China is one of the fastest growing national markets, with 2026 demand around $430 million and expected growth above 9% annually through 2033 as orthopedic care penetration rises in both coastal and inland provinces. Expansion is tied to a larger elderly population, improved access to advanced imaging, and growing willingness among tertiary hospitals to adopt arthroscopic repair over conservative treatment when tears are severe. Local procurement rules and price competition have pushed vendors to sharpen their product mix, and investment is concentrating on cost-efficient anchors, repair kits, and rehabilitation products. As Stats N Data has observed in similar orthopedic segments, the strongest gains in China typically come when clinical adoption and reimbursement improve at the same time, rather than from price-led volume alone.
Germany remains a high-value European market, estimated at about $240 million in 2026, with steady growth near 6.4% through 2033. Hospital purchasing is shaped by strict quality standards, structured rehabilitation pathways, and a mature orthopedic specialist base that favors proven implant performance and predictable outcomes. The market is supported by a large older population and well-developed insurance coverage, but hospital budget discipline limits fast replacement of established products unless evidence clearly supports better healing or lower revision risk. Surgical centers and rehabilitation clinics continue to invest in faster return-to-function protocols, which keeps demand balanced across implants, pain control, and physiotherapy services.
Japan contributes roughly $260 million in 2026 and is expected to expand at about 6.8% annually through 2033, driven by one of the world’s oldest populations and strong attention to early intervention. Physicians in Japan often favor careful surgical selection and high-quality fixation systems, with demand rising for smaller-incision procedures that reduce hospital stay and support faster mobility in older patients. Investment is concentrated in premium hospital networks and orthopedic centers, while manufacturers continue to adapt to local expectations on durability, precision, and post-operative recovery. The market is also influenced by a strong rehabilitation culture, which supports continued spending beyond the operating room.
India is smaller in current value but has one of the widest growth runways, with 2026 market size near $190 million and forecast CAGR above 10% through 2033. Rising sports injuries, workplace strain, and growing awareness among urban patients are expanding the treatment base, while private hospital chains are adding advanced arthroscopy capabilities in major cities. Cost sensitivity remains high, so demand is concentrated in affordable fixation products, diagnostics, and rehabilitation services, although premium implants are gaining share in tier-one hospitals. Investment is also moving into training, outpatient surgery, and localized manufacturing, which helps widen access beyond top metro areas.
South Korea, at about $140 million in 2026, is expected to grow around 7.1% annually through 2033, supported by a technologically sophisticated healthcare system and strong adoption of minimally invasive shoulder surgery. The country has a relatively high rate of specialist-led diagnosis, and patients tend to seek treatment earlier, which improves the commercial mix for repair systems and post-operative rehabilitation. Hospitals are selective about product evidence and cost effectiveness, so suppliers need clear clinical differentiation to win share. Device makers continue to invest in advanced fixation and imaging-linked planning tools, particularly in major urban centers.
Italy’s market is estimated at $165 million in 2026 and should advance at roughly 6.3% annually through 2033, led by an aging population and dependable demand from public and private orthopedic services. Procedure volume is supported by chronic shoulder degeneration, sports-related tears, and broad access to specialist care in the north, while southern regions remain somewhat more constrained by facility capacity. Purchasing remains price disciplined, which favors suppliers that can bundle implants with rehabilitation and service support. France follows a similar pattern, with 2026 value near $185 million and growth of about 6.5% through 2033, underpinned by strong hospital networks, structured reimbursement, and a steady shift toward ambulatory surgery.
The United Kingdom is estimated at $175 million in 2026 and is projected to grow at around 6.2% through 2033, though treatment access is still influenced by waiting lists and budget prioritization in public care. Private providers and independent surgical centers are filling part of the gap, especially for patients willing to pay for faster intervention and rehabilitation. Canada, at roughly $120 million in 2026, is expected to grow near 6.6% annually as orthopedic capacity expands gradually and patients seek shorter recovery options. Mexico is smaller at about $95 million but may grow above 8.5% annually, helped by private hospital investment, medical tourism, and better access in large cities. Brazil is estimated near $145 million in 2026, with growth around 7.8%, supported by a large injury burden and expanding private orthopedic care, although payer fragmentation remains a brake on high-end adoption.
Turkey, Indonesia, and Vietnam represent important emerging demand pools, with 2026 market sizes of about $70 million, $60 million, and $48 million respectively. Turkey should grow near 7.4% annually as both public and private facilities invest in orthopedic services, while inflation and reimbursement pressure still affect product mix. Indonesia and Vietnam are expected to post faster growth near 9% and 9.2% as hospital modernization, sports medicine, and urban income growth expand treatment access. South Africa, at about $42 million in 2026, is expected to grow around 6.1%, supported by private hospital demand and gradual widening of specialist care, while Australia is estimated near $110 million and should rise at about 6.7% as procedure volumes remain stable and outpatient pathways deepen. Thailand, Spain, the Netherlands, Poland, Malaysia, Argentina, and the Gulf markets add meaningful regional depth, with 2026 values of roughly $58 million, $130 million, $74 million, $66 million, $52 million, and $63 million respectively, and each is tracking growth between 6% and 8.8% depending on reimbursement, private sector investment, and orthopedic infrastructure. In the Gulf, Saudi Arabia is near $85 million and the United Arab Emirates about $46 million in 2026, both expanding quickly as hospital modernization and high-income patient demand support premium procedures.
By type, surgical treatment remains the largest segment, accounting for about 58% of 2026 market value, because full-thickness tears and persistent pain often require repair, fixation, or reconstruction. Arthroscopic repair dominates this category, followed by open and mini-open procedures where tear complexity or tissue quality warrants it, while anchors, sutures, and biologic augmentation products provide much of the accessory revenue. Non-surgical management holds the remaining share through physical therapy, pain control, injections, activity modification, and bracing, and it remains important for partial tears and older patients with lower surgical tolerance. Application patterns are led by hospitals and ambulatory surgical centers, which together represent more than two-thirds of spending, while rehabilitation clinics and specialty orthopedic practices capture recurring follow-up and therapy-related income.
The core driver is the steady rise in diagnosed shoulder injuries among older adults and active working-age patients, especially where repetitive motion, trauma, and sports participation intersect. Treatment rates are also improving because MRI and ultrasound access is broadening, which shortens time to diagnosis and lifts conversion into specialty care. Another important driver is outpatient migration, as many procedures now move from inpatient settings to lower-cost ambulatory centers without reducing device demand. In addition, payers and providers increasingly value faster recovery and lower revision rates, which supports premium fixation systems when clinical evidence is strong.
Restraints are centered on cost, reimbursement pressure, and the fact that not every tear requires surgery. Conservative treatment often remains the first step, especially for older patients, lower-income groups, or healthcare systems with limited surgical budgets. Reimbursement variation across countries can slow adoption of biologics and higher-priced repair systems, while patient compliance with rehabilitation programs affects final outcomes and repeat purchasing behavior. These constraints keep pricing discipline high and make market share gains dependent on evidence, training, and service quality rather than product novelty alone.
The biggest opportunity lies in earlier intervention and better pathway design, particularly in markets where shoulder pain is still underdiagnosed or treated late. Growth potential also exists in biologic augmentation, collagen-based scaffolds, and next-generation implants that reduce retear risk in complex tears. Emerging markets offer room for expansion as hospital capacity improves and insurance coverage widens, especially in India, Southeast Asia, and Latin America. Suppliers that combine devices with education, surgical training, and rehabilitation support are better positioned to convert latent demand into repeat revenue, a point often highlighted in internal market mapping by Stats N Data.
The main challenge is balancing clinical performance with price sensitivity across highly diverse healthcare systems. Surgeons want secure fixation, low complication rates, and predictable recovery, while hospitals want simpler inventory, shorter operating time, and lower total episode cost. Competition is intensifying as local manufacturers enter several price-sensitive markets, forcing global suppliers to defend share with outcome data and service depth. Supply chain stability, regulatory clearance timing, and the need for surgeon familiarity also remain important execution risks, particularly when new devices are introduced without a clear training advantage.
Technology trends are moving toward smaller-incision repair, improved anchor designs, better suture handling, and stronger biologic support for tendon healing. Imaging-guided planning and arthroscopy visualization continue to improve procedure precision, while digital rehabilitation platforms are helping providers monitor recovery outside the clinic. There is also steady interest in patient-specific treatment planning, including tear classification tools that help physicians choose between conservative therapy and surgery. Product innovation is increasingly judged not only by fixation strength but by healing environment, reduced revision rates, and ease of use in outpatient settings.
Regionally, North America remains the revenue leader because of procedure volume, high device adoption, and premium pricing, while Europe contributes stable demand anchored in reimbursement systems and aging demographics. Asia Pacific is the fastest-expanding region, driven by China, India, Japan, and South Korea, where hospital investment and access to specialist care are rising together. Latin America and the Middle East are smaller in absolute value but offer attractive growth from low bases, particularly where private hospital chains are building orthopedic capacity. Across regions, the winning model is shifting toward integrated care pathways that connect diagnosis, repair, and rehabilitation rather than selling implants as a stand-alone product.

The Rotator Cuff Injury Treatment market is a crucial segment within the broader healthcare and orthopedic industries, focused on addressing one of the most common shoulder injuries seen in sports, workplace environments, and aging populations. The rotator cuff, a group of four muscles and their tendons that stabilize the shoulder joint, can become damaged due to trauma, repetitive strain, or degenerative conditions. This injury not only affects physical ability but also impacts the quality of life for millions.
